Abstract
A general regression program KILET written in FORTRAN IV for an IBM PC and other computers (MV 4000 Eclipse and EC 1033) enables (i) to model multicomponent kinetic data (ii) to load the smooth curves with random noise of required level (iii) to evaluate rate constants and/or simultaneously concentrations. Complete statistical analysis of residuals is performed. The program can be used for the discrimination of chemical kinetic models and for analytical purposes.
